Conclusion: Making Informative Choices
When considering which barb fittings to use, always verify these 3 metrics: ① material compatibility, ② pressure ratings, ③ ease of installation. Exploring Barb Fittings: The Essential Option
Barb fittings are crucial in many applications, be it in plumbing, automotive, or other trades. These fittings create secure connections by utilizing the barbed design—a feature that ensures minimal chances of leaks. When you’re selecting fittings, remember, the choice of material and size can greatly influence performance. Understanding Barbed Tube Fittings: A Quick Overview
Barbed tube fittings serve a similar function and are designed specifically for connecting flexibly to tubing. The way they grip ensures there’s no slippage, which can cause unwanted leakage.
